Abuse Prayer

Father, I am tired of suffering at the abuse of my spouse. I ask that You deliver me now from the guilty thinking, hopeful fantasies, denial, or the fears that have kept me in this situation.

Your Word says that my spouse should love me as they love their own body and care for me just as Christ cares for the church and gave Himself for it (Ephesians 5:28). I realize that my spouse does not love me because love does not hurt anyone (Romans 13:10).

Whether their problem stems from a generational curse of spousal abuse, a chemical imbalance in the brain, or any other cause, I ask that You deliver them now. Send someone across their path who will show them the way out of their bondage. Give me the wisdom to protect myself from their physical or verbal abuse because my body and my mind are Your temple and should not be dishonored in this way (1 Corinthians 6:19).

Give me the courage to remove myself from this abusive environment. I need a place of refuge and support. I stand on Your Word that says You will supply every need I have according to Your great riches in glory (Philippians 4:19). I ask this in Jesus’ name, Amen.
